p-Anisaldehyde Uses

  p-ANISALDEHYDE(123-11-5) is mainly used for the preparation of vanilla, spices, apricot, butter, cinnamon and chocolate, caramel, cherry, walnuts, raspberry, strawberry, mint flavor. It can also be used for daily Flavor and Flavors. The pharmaceutical industry for the manufacture of anti-microbial drugs hydroxyl ammonia benzyl penicillin, is the anti-histamine drug intermediates.

p-Anisaldehyde Production

 p-Anisaldehyde (CAS NO.123-11-5) is made by the oxidation of anethole (the chief constituent of anise, star anise, and fennel oils).
  CH3OC6H4CH=CHCH3 → CH3OC6H4CH=O
Anethole is obtained from the higher-boiling fractions of pine oil.

p-Anisaldehyde Toxicity Data With Reference

Organism Test Type Route Reported Dose (Normalized Dose) Effect Source
guinea pig LD50 oral 1260mg/kg (1260mg/kg) BEHAVIORAL: SOMNOLENCE (GENERAL DEPRESSED ACTIVITY) Food and Cosmetics Toxicology. Vol. 2, Pg. 327, 1964.
mouse LD50 oral 1859mg/kg (1859mg/kg) GASTROINTESTINAL: NECROTIC GHANGES

GASTROINTESTINAL: OTHER CHANGES

LIVER: FATTY LIVER DEGERATION
Gigiena i Sanitariya. For English translation, see HYSAAV. Vol. 58(8), Pg. 20, 1993.
rabbit LD50 skin > 5gm/kg (5000mg/kg)   Food and Cosmetics Toxicology. Vol. 12, Pg. 823, 1974.
rat LD50 oral 1510mg/kg (1510mg/kg) BEHAVIORAL: SOMNOLENCE (GENERAL DEPRESSED ACTIVITY) Food and Cosmetics Toxicology. Vol. 2, Pg. 327, 1964.

Moderately toxic by ingestion. A skin irritant. Mutation data reported. Combustible liquid. When heated to decomposition it emits acrid smoke and irritating fumes.
